Medical Expert Witnesses

Expert witness testimony by medical experts is an essential element in asbestos cases. Medical experts provide their opinions on whether or not the plaintiff suffers from asbestos-related diseases, like lung cancer or mesothelioma. Their opinions are based on the results of medical tests and other information that includes the patient's symptoms and the severity of the disease. These experts are usually well-known and have testified in hundreds, or even hundreds of cases. This makes them more credible to the jury.

An experienced attorney will have connections to these professionals and can help to build the strongest case for their clients. Asbestos lawyers may have their own databases of medical and other data that they can pull from to help to support their clients' claims. They know how to locate the most reliable sources of information and use them to build a strong argument for their clients.

Asbestos lawyers usually work for national firms that handle mesothelioma cases on a national basis. They will know the local rules and court systems of different jurisdictions, and will be able make lawsuits using the appropriate state courts system to obtain the best possible outcome for their clients.

In these instances, defendants must pay close attention to the qualifications and training of the plaintiff's experts witnesses. They could be subject to Daubert or Frye challenges. They must examine whether the expert witnesses have adequate knowledge or experience on which to base their opinions and ensure that the internal coherence of the witness's opinions is sufficient. Defense attorneys should also make sure that the expert witnesses are able to accurately identify their sources and that they are legitimate.

While identifying and vetting these experts might seem like a daunting task The early identification of competent experts can help defendants to avoid an unsuccessful Daubert challenge or Frye challenge. This can save defendants a lot of time and money, as well as stress.

Time Limits

A wide variety of personal injury cases have a statute of limitation or a time limit to file a lawsuit. The laws differ by state, but they can impact the rights of a person's legal rights when not adhered to. An asbestos lawyer can help victims meet deadlines and determine if they are in the right position to file a lawsuit.

Due to the latency period of mesothelioma and asbestos-related diseases and other asbestos-related ailments asbestos-related diseases are subject to a distinct time-limit. Mesothelioma patients might not exhibit symptoms or be diagnosed until a long time after their initial exposure to asbestos. This is why the statute of limitations does not start to run when the victim was injured or exposed but rather when they were diagnosed with an asbestos lawsuit-related illness.

This can complicate asbestos lawsuits (click through the next web page), especially when a claimant has multiple claims against a variety of defendants. Typically, the applicable statute of limitations will depend on a variety of variables that include when symptoms began, why and when a victim stopped working, the location they resided and worked and the location they received their treatment. These factors may also impact the length of time that the statutory clock may be, since certain states have shorter deadlines than others.

A plaintiff who develops a second asbestos related disease after they settle their original issue is considered to have a new complication and a new statute of law applies. This may permit a plaintiff to sue defendants for different ailments, such as lung cancer, even when they settled with them previously.

The same is true for wrongful death lawsuits, which are filed by the family members or close friends of a victim who has died from mesothelioma. The best mesothelioma lawyers know the rules of wrongful-death suits and will ensure the claim is filed before the statute of limitations expires. If a lawsuit isn't filed before the statute of limitations runs out, the victim's family won't be able to seek compensation for their losses. This includes compensation for medical expenses and income loss and the pain and suffering that comes with an asbestos-related illness.
